I hope we win out and finish 10-2 (probability under 25%, I think). I pray, however, we do NOT sneak into a BCS bowl game. This is because one bowl game ***-raping is horrendous but bowl game *** rapes in successive years would be crushing. Sneaking into a BCS bowl game this year through the back door will have a cruelly ironic meaning after the game given the likely teams we'd have to play. Any possible match up in a BCS bowl game has us badly over-matched.

We have a history of sneaking into BCS bowl games with less-than-competitive teams in the not-too-distant past. We got slaughtered in both of them.

We have not had one dominant win over a good team all year. Yes, we snuck by MSU and ASU but they were not dominant wins (which I define as wins by at least 14 points). On the other hand we have escaped with our lives against weak teams (Purdue and Navy come to mind).

ND doesn't need the BCS cash and we'll be far better off playing a truly competitive game in a non-BCS bowl.

I'm afraid BYU or Stanford, or both of them, are going to moot any chance of our getting into a BCS bowl. Even if we beat both of them, however, I don't think we belong no matter what our fan appeal is,

Wanting to get into a BCS bowl game is a case of "be careful what you wish for" in my honest opinion.

I love ND football and want what's best for the school, the football program and its future. Getting slaughtered in a BCS Bowl game this year doesn't do ND football any good whatsoever. I think it's a big negative for recruiting when compared to a win in a lesser bowl. Yes, miracles happen and we might win a BCS bowl game. Would you put your money on that happening? Not me.

I invite any rational arguments proving me wrong about this. Thank you for anyone who responds with substance and not invective.

To be honest, I agree with some of your premises. The truth is that we haven't won a big BCS bowl since they've been adopted, thats some horrible luck right there. Part of the problem is that we have been paired in some horrible situations. The media has some of the blame there, but being ND we've got that strong following so we make an attractive bowl match up because of the $$$. Of course, the other problem is the fact that we've been lacking the kind of coaching we need to succeed at the top tier. If we're going to succeed, BK is going to be the guy though. I don't think we're going to be able to attract anyone that's better, and anyone that is better will probably bring values or methods that don't fit with the University. It's not the easy road, and we've paid for it, but if we get the opportunity to play in a BCS game I think we need to take it. If you don't play in the big games against good competition, then it's hard to learn from your mistakes and get better. I certainly don't want another 'Bama blowout either, but if we were to face a team like Oklahoma again I think we'd have a better outcome...that is, if we're not completely injury depleted by then.
